  • RF Milliwatt Meters

    Type NDB-2 and NDB-3 - National RF, Inc

    National RF’s Type NDB-2 and NDB-3 RF Milliwatt Meters are affordable pieces of test equipment for both the RF laboratory and the home experimenter. Both provide a digital reading of RF power in dB reference 1 milliwatt of power into a 50 ohm load (i.e. 0 dBm). The circuitry consists of a low noise logarithmic amplifier that drives a digital A/D converting meter circuit. The lowest power levels that can be read are about –73 dBm (approximately 40 microvolts or .00000003 milliwatts). The maximum power input should not exceed 10 milliwatts (+10 dBm or .010 watts) when inputed without attenuation. An internal attenuator is provided and described in the next section.

  • EMCTD Broadband RF Safety Systems

    LBA Group, Inc

    The EMCTD analog Smart Fieldmeter® is easy to read and to operate. The EMCTD broadband electromagnetic probe covers the 0.2 to 3000 MHz spectrum where most common industrial, communications, medical and government RF emitters are found. The ANGPE-3000  system enables checking of home, office, and workplace RF levels. The system is designed to conveniently measure RF levels around WiFi access points, RFID systems and rooftop antennas; to find transmitter cabinet radiation, locate transmission line leaks, to identify non-radiating antenna elements, and much more. With the supplied NIST-traceable calibration, this system supports laboratory testing of RF devices in compliance with present EMC and RF safety standards.

  • Textile Testing Instruments

    Dongguan Amade Instruments Technology Co., Ltd

    Textile testing instruments are developed to determine the quality and performance of various fibrillar component fabrics, structural fabrics, garments, home textiles and other textiles by physical and chemical methods in conformance with international standards. By using scientific testing methods to judge the quality of materials or final products, manufacturers of textiles are capable of detecting the defects and unqualified products to correct problems in time, conducive to reducing loss and maintaining the business reputation. Testings cover tensile strength, tearing strength, seam slippage, joint strength, bursting strength, resistance to wear, pilling resistance, color fastness to washing, rubbing fastness, light fastness, color fastness to perspiration, dimension stability, inflaming retarding test etc.
